    Turkey’s Fragile EU Prospects

    Turkey observed a national day of mourning Wednesday a day after a terrorist attack at Istanbul’s Ataturk airport killed dozens and injured hundreds of people. This latest attack has further shaken Turkey’s carefully-curated image in the region. The nation has long been a crossroads between Europe and the Middle East, and it has marketed itself as a liberal beacon among Islamic countries in its campaign for European Union membership. Turkey has been trying to get into the EU since 1987, and so far the EU has been lukewarm to the request.
